Output 40d616d08cc346f627a2ca1afa88ea783fc55668d773389bf2128e2fbc430f31:9

value
4240164
script pubkey
OP_0 OP_PUSHBYTES_20 98ca031ab29bcfaed0ce3a959e8269b495763ac7
address
bc1qnr9qxx4jn086a5xw822eaqnfkj2hvwk89kpdt9
transaction
40d616d08cc346f627a2ca1afa88ea783fc55668d773389bf2128e2fbc430f31
confirmations
157893
spent
true